@rutgersmom123 May I ask if you have seronegative rheumatoid arthritis? Are you seeing a rheumatologist for treatment?
Sometimes it takes a few tries to find a doc who accepts that about 20% of RA is sero-negative and treats it. I have had symptoms for about 20 years and self-managed until 2025, but finally my body would no longer tolerate NSAID's. My pulmonologist, of all people, sent me to a wonderful rheumatologist, and we are still working on getting the beast under control.
